As of January 2025, Kai Polsterer is the new Scientific Director of HITS, taking over from Tilmann Gneiting who had been Scientific Director for the last 2 years. The new deputy Scientific Director will be Rebecca Wade (@rebecca-wade.bsky.social). Read more here: ow.ly/HMlS50UBKUg Photos ©HITS

After 15 years, we say goodbye to group leader Frauke Gräter (@graeterlab.bsky.social) who will assume her new role as director of the Max-Planck-Institute for Polymer Research in Mainz as of January 2025. Read more about her time at HITS here: www.h-its.org/2024/12/19/f...

New findings by scientists at HITS (Giulia Paiardi & Rebecca Wade) and Heidelberg University on how specific polysaccharides act as accomplices in SARS-CoV-2 infections, uncovering human susceptibility to the virus. Potential new therapeutic approaches unlocked: ow.ly/hify50TObUF
